Venice: Lucio Spineda, 1628. SOLE EDITION. Hardcover. Fine. Contemporary limp vellum in fine condition (paste-down torn). The text is in excellent condition with a few instances of light toning (in gatherings O, S, and X), and a small worm-track in the margin of the first few lvs. The text is illustrated with woodcut diagrams. An extremely rare book. OCLC cites only 1 copy in North America (Columbia University) and 5 other institutional copies outside of Italy (two in Denmark, two in France, one in Switzerland). Vagnetti described the book without having seen a copy. Riccardi described an incomplete copy. First (and only) edition of this wide-ranging work on selected problems in perspective and its underlying geometry, largely organized around what the author considers to be commonly found theoretical or practical errors. Venice: Lorenzo Basilio, 1728. SOLE EDITION. Hardcover. Fine. Bound in contemporary carta rustica. Untrimmed, with deckled edges preserved throughout. Fine condition with just a few leaves spotted. Extremely rare. OCLC and KVK locate 4 copies outside of Italy, only 1 of which is in North America (Harvard Law Library). The work has been attributed to Bartolommeo Mlechiori, who also authored a book on criminal law, "Miscellanea di materie criminali, volgari e latine, composta secondo le leggi civili e venete" (Venezia, 1741). The author's name appears only once in the book, on the final leaf of text as "Bart. Florence: [Gianstephano di Carlo da Pavia], 23 October, 1508. THIRD EDITION, mimicking the layout and using the same woodcuts as the edition published at Florence by Bartolommeo di Libri, 24 Oct. 1495. Another Florentine edition, undated, was printed by Lorenzo Morgiani and Johannes Petri, ca. 1495-1496. Hardcover. Fine. Bound in 20th c. brown morocco. A fine copy. Savonarola's name has been censored on the title. With a fine woodcut scene on the title page showing Savonarola conversing with the Abbess and sisters of the Monastero delle Murate. On the final leaf is a Crucifixion scene with the Virgin, St. John, and Mary Magdalene. These woodcuts were used in Bartolommeo di Libri's 1495 first edition. Printer from BM STC Italian; place and date of printing from colophon. Sander, who attributes the printing to De Libri, regards the 1508 date of this third edition as erroneous, and assigns it to 1498, perhaps because of the use of the same woodcuts. Palermo: nella stamperia di Francesco Valenza, 1774.
Price: $2,600.00
Quarto: 25.7 x 19.5 cm. Engraved portrait, [2] lvs, III-XLIII p., 2 folding plates.
SOLE EDITION.
Bound in attractive contemporary patterned pasteboards (corners bumped, minor wear.) The text is in excellent condition. The two folding engravings show the funeral monument and the catafalque. Clean tear (mended, no loss) to first plate. Marginal tear, not affecting image to second plate. The portrait was etched by Giuseppe Garofalo after a drawing by Pietro Giaconia. The 2 foldings plates (see below) were also etched by Garofalo.
An unusual funeral book of the late Sicilian Baroque, commemorating funeral rites for the prosperous Sicilian lawyer Giuseppe Maria Jurato (d. 10 October 1712), judge of the Grand Civil Court of Palermo and Prosecutor of the Royal Court.
